Question 4 of 5
Which chromosomal abnormality is often characteristic of infantile ALL?
Correct Answer: A
Rationale: The t(4;11) translocation is commonly found in infantile ALL and is associated with a poor prognosis.
Question 5 of 5
Which clinical sign is pathognomonic of rubella?
Correct Answer: D
Rationale: Postauricular, occipital, and cervical lymphadenopathy are characteristic signs of rubella, often preceding the rash.
